    Sherri W.

    I enjoyed the All Very Strawberry Ice Cream Cake Jar but due to the machine for the strawberry ice cream being down, I had to replace the ice cream with a different flavor. I opted for vanilla ice cream. I ordered the mini which was sufficient for an afternoon sweet treat. The jar is layered with the strawberry cupcake on the bottom, icing, strawberry crunch, and topped with ice cream. It's a wonderful combination but the plastic spoons available made it difficult to access the cupcake with the other layers. I would order the cake jar again but will use my own spoon so I don't spend time trying to pull up the cupcake smashed at the bottom to enjoy with the other layers. They have a high top table ledge to sit and enjoy your treat inside if you choose. It sits across from the workspace where you can watch them make your treat.

    Jo L.

    FOOD We had their taro bubble tea & matcha/taro swirled ice cream. It's enormous and even when we came with empty stomachs, it was still difficult to split between two. The soft serve itself was the star of the show, so I definitely recommend to try it, but the milk tea itself was a little overshadowed by the powderiness of the milk tea. The tapioca pearls were also hard and tough to chew. SERVICE The staff are kind and friendly. AMBIANCE There's some bar seating available inside the shop. We went at a good time since there were only two other people there but during busier hours, it can be difficult to find a spot to eat. PARKING Parking garages at a fee are available nearby. Paid street parking is also available at a limited capacity.

    Ritesh S.

    Oh wow! We had a hankering for soft serve but couldn't find something that was still open late until we stumbled upon this place! What a treat! We took the drive over to the Chinatown location and found easy street parking right outside. Inside, it's a pretty sizeable operation, with ordering available pretty much as you walk in and then an area to the side to enjoy the ice cream in case you're sticking around. We chose to do two flavors - earl grey and taro with the gingerbread toppings - so good! I think the toppings really worked with these flavors and we both enjoyed the combination. They have options for cones but given the size of the portion, glad we went with a cup! The workers were really nice and patient while we asked about what we have as options and ways to mix and match. Overall - solid creamy soft serve and great service to boot! Also glad it's open later than other area ice cream shops! Looking forward to more visits!

    5 stars for Bud and Marilyn's? I recently gave The Love 5 stars for its fried chicken!…read more The Marilyn's Fried Chicken I had this evening was every bit as good! I'm not sure why I waited so long to try the chicken at Bud and Marilyn's, but better late than never! They serve a LARGE 1/2 chicken. I started with the thigh. I was smitten by the first bite. I was told the chicken is soaked in a buttermilk brine for 24-48 hours - dipped in a buttermilk dredge - covered with their 'secret recipe' seasoned flour - and fried in a 'pressure fryer' that cooks the chicken in 12 minutes. It was perfectly fried - so crispy - the texture and seasoning of the exterior coating was incredible. The chicken was tender and juicy - the thigh was the juiciest - I didn't get to try the drumstick as I was too full! I had the thigh and 1/2 the breast. The breast is my favorite and I savored each large delicious piece I broke apart. It's important to pick up the chicken and eat it by hand - I did cut mine in half for a picture - but didn't use a fork to eat it - you lose the 'panache'of the meal. I didn't use the hot sauce served with the chicken - I brought my own bottle of honey and poured it over the chicken and biscuits. It was heavenly! Which brings me to the Biscuits! The dish comes with 2 large fluffy buttermilk biscuits - they were golden brown on the outside and tender and fluffy on the inside! They had such a rich, buttery flavor. I took several pieces of chicken and layered them on pieces of biscuit, drizzled with honey! It was truly a 5 star fried chicken and biscuit dinner!
